The Moonwell DeFi protocol suffered a $1.78 million loss after an AI system, Claude Opus 4.6, co-authored faulty code for a price oracle. The misconfiguration led to cbETH being drastically undervalued, triggering mass liquidations and significant financial harm to users and the protocol.[AI generated]
Why's our monitor labelling this an incident or hazard?
The event involves an AI system explicitly mentioned as co-authoring the smart contract code that contained a critical bug leading to a significant financial loss. The harm (financial loss) has already occurred, and the AI's involvement in the development process is a contributing factor to the vulnerability. Although the flaw could have been made by a human developer, the AI-assisted coding played a role in the incident. Therefore, this qualifies as an AI Incident due to the realized harm caused by the AI system's involvement in the development and deployment of the vulnerable contract.[AI generated]
